RTF fájlformátum

Az RTF fájlok áttekintése

RTF, vagy Rich Text Format, egy sokoldalú fájlformátumot hozott a Microsoft, hogy megkönnyítse a dokumentumcserét a különböző platformok és alkalmazások. tervezett kölcsönös átjárhatósággal a gondolatban, RTP lehetővé teszi a felhasználók számára a formázott szöveg és a grafika átvitele különböző szófeldolgozó szoftverek nélkül elveszíti az alapvető formatervezési részleteket.

Az RTF fájlokat a fejlesztők és a technikai szakemberek széles körben használják egyszerűségük és nagyszabású kompatibilitásuk miatt. Függetlenül attól, hogy egy Windows PC, macOS vagy Linux gépen dolgozik-e, azRTF biztosítja a dokumentumok olvasható és jól formázott maradását. Ez a formátum a Microsoft Word for Macintosh korai napjai óta működik, és továbbra is támogatható a modern alkalmazásokban.

kulcsfontosságú jellemzők

  • Cross-platform kompatibilitás: Biztosítja a dokumentumok következetes formázását a különböző operációs rendszereken.
  • Egyszerű szerkezet: Könnyű szétválasztani és generálni, ami ideális a fejlesztők számára.
  • Standardizált Syntax: A szöveg és a grafika kódolásához jól meghatározott vezérlő szót és szimbólumokat használ.
  • Backward Compatibility: Az új verziók megtekinthetik a régebbi RTF fájlokat, miközben fenntartják a backward kompatibilitást.
  • Lightweight: Kisebb fájlméret a bonyolultabb formátumokhoz képest, mint a DOCX.

Technikai specifikációk

Formátum szerkezet

Az RTF egy 7 bites ASCII-alapú tiszta szöveges formátum, amely könnyen olvasható és párosítható. használja a vezérlő szavakat és szimbólumokat a formázási információk kódolására, lehetővé téve a gazdag szövegfunkciók képviseletét egy egyszerű szöveg alapú szerkezetben.

Core összetevők

  • Control Words: Az olyan parancsok, amelyek formázási tulajdonságokat határoznak meg, mint a betűtípus, a méret és a színek.
  • Control Szimbólumok: Speciális karakterek előre meghatározott jelentésekkel, amelyek a konkrét cselekedeteket vagy állapotokat jelzik.
  • Csoportok: Kezekbe zárva {}, csoportok lehetővé teszik, hogy meghatározza a sík szerkezetek, mint a bekezdések, szakaszok, és táblák.

Szabványok és kompatibilitás

Az RTF összhangban van a Microsoft hivatalos specifikációival, amelyek nyilvánosan elérhetőek. A formátum támogatja a hátsó kompatibilitást a különböző verziók között, biztosítva, hogy a régebbi RTP-fájlokat problémamentesen olvashatják a legújabb szoftverrel.

Történelem és evolúció

Az RTF-t először 1987-ben vezették be a Microsoft Word 3.0 részeként a Macintosh számára, és gyorsan népszerűséget szerzett platformközi képességei miatt. Az évek során számos felülvizsgálatot végeztek, a legújabb hivatalos verzió pedig 1.9.1 volt, amelyet a Microsofttól 2008 márciusában közzétettek.

Az RTF fájlokkal való együttműködés

RTF fájlok megnyitása

Az RTF fájlokat különböző szoftveralkalmazások segítségével lehet megnyitni különböző operációs rendszereken:

  • Windows: Microsoft Word, Notepad++ és LibreOffice Writer.
  • MacOS: az Apple Pages, a TextEdit és a LibreOffice Writer.
  • Linux: Gedit és LibreOffice Writer.

Ezek az eszközök támogatják az RTF funkcióinak teljes körét, és biztosítják, hogy a dokumentumok megfelelően jelenjenek meg.

Az RTF fájlok átalakítása

Közös átalakítási forgatókönyvek közé tartozik az RTF fájlok PDF vagy HTML webes kiadása. Míg bizonyos szoftvereszközök használhatók ezekre a konverziók, fontos, hogy válasszon egy eszközt, amely megőrzi a formázást pontosan. Általános megközelítések magukban foglalják a dokumentumfeldolgozás APIs vagy beépített funkciók szót feldolgozó, mint a Microsoft Word és LibreOffice.

RTF fájlok létrehozása

Az RTF fájlokat általában a népszerű szófeldolgozó alkalmazások, mint például a Microsoft Word, az Apple Pages és a LibreOffice Writer segítségével hozták létre.Ezek az eszközök könnyen használható felületeket biztosítanak a jól formázott dokumentumok létrehozásához, amelyeket könnyedén megoszthatunk különböző platformokon.

Általános használati esetek

  • Cross-Platform Document Exchange: Ideális formázott dokumentumok megosztására a Windows, a macOS és a Linux felhasználók között.
  • Email hozzáférések: Tökéletes a stílusos szöveget e-mailen keresztül küldeni, anélkül, hogy a címzett végére speciális szoftverre lenne szükség.
  • Web Publishing: Az RTF fájlok HTML vagy PDF formátumú átalakítása a webalapú dokumentum megtekintéséhez.

Előnyök és korlátozások

Az előnyök:

  • Cross-platform kompatibilitás: Egységes formázást biztosít a különböző operációs rendszerek között.
  • Egyszerűség és könnyű használat: Könnyű szétválasztani, generálni és programozni.
  • széles körű támogatás: Sokféle alkalmazás és platform támogatja.

A korlátozások:

  • Limited Formatting Options: A modern formátumokhoz képest, mint például a DOCX vagy a PDF, az RTF-nek nincs fejlett formázási funkciója.
  • Biztonsági aggodalmak: A tiszta szöveges természetének köszönhetően nagyobb valószínűséggel jár a biztonsági sebezhetőségekkel szemben, mint a bináris formátumokban.

Fejlesztő erőforrások

Az RTF fájlokkal való programozást különböző API-k és könyvtárak segítségével támogatják. kód példák és végrehajtási útmutatók hamarosan hozzáadódnak.

Gyakran feltett kérdések

  • Hogyan nyithatok egy RTF fájlt a számítógépre?

  • Az olyan alkalmazásokat, mint a Microsoft Word, az Apple Pages vagy a LibreOffice Writer használhatja az RTF fájlok megnyitásához.

  • Az RTF fájlokat PDF-re konvertálhatom?

  • Igen, az RTF fájlokat PDF-re konvertálhatja olyan eszközökkel, mint például az Adobe Acrobat vagy a Word processzorok beépített funkciói.

  • Milyen az RTF specifikációk legújabb verziója?

  • Az RTF specifikációk legújabb hivatalos verzióját a Microsoft 2008 márciusában jelentette be (verszió 1.9.1).

References

 Magyar